Ma'am there is a question in which area of a rectangle is 221 cm2. if breadth increases by 2 cm and length decreases by 2 cm, it becomes the square. what is the perimeter of original rectangle is? This was a question asked in mock test of Accenture. Plz explain it ma,am.........PLZ
consider one of the sides as a and the other side as a+4 ( since they have said that it willl become a square if you increase one by 2 and decrease the other by 2). now you get a quadratic -> a(a+4) = 221. Solve this to get the sides as 13,17
IT WILL BE 60, AS (l-2)=(b+2) [sides of square are equal] than equate the value in l*b=221 , u will get a quadratic equation of b(square)+4b-221=0 , after solving u will get 13 and 17 , Now perimeter = 2(13+17)[ formula:2*(l+b)] , u will get 60.
